Key Responsibilities as a Quality Engineer: As a Quality Engineer, you will be responsible for leading all quality-related processes to support both customer and production requirements. Your day-to-day responsibilities will include, but are not limited to: • Customer and Internal Concern Resolution: Proactively addressing quality issues and ensuring effective resolutions., • Auditing: Conducting internal audits of systems, processes, and products to ensure compliance and continual improvement., • NPI Support: Supporting New Product Introduction (NPI) with APQP (Advanced Product Quality Planning) quality requirements., • Internal Training: Delivering training on quality-related topics to ensure the team meets required quality standards., • Audit Support: Assisting with both customer and supplier audits as necessary., • Investigation Leadership: Leading root cause investigations using the 8D methodology to resolve quality concerns., • Reporting: Generating and distributing key quality reports to stakeholders, tracking progress, and ensuring timely closure of issues., • Driving Improvements: Identifying and implementing quality improvement initiatives within manufacturing operations. Accountabilities as a Quality Engineer: • Ensure internal audits are completed on time as per the audit plan., • Lead 8D investigations and ensure timely closure of reports., • Maintain process adherence and quality compliance at all times., • Ensure all quality data and reports are completed in a timely and accurate manner., • Ensure all associates are aware of the required quality standards and are adequately trained. Technical Skill Requirements: • IATF16949 Internal Auditor certification is essential (Second Party Auditor experience is a plus)., • 5+ years of First-Tier Automotive supply experience is highly desirable., • Strong knowledge of Core Tools (APQP, PPAP, FMEA, Control Plans)., • In-depth knowledge and experience in using 8D methodology for root cause analysis., • Intermediate Microsoft Office skills (Excel, Word, PowerPoint)., • Experience in Coatings manufacturing environments is an advantage., • Proven experience working with Automotive OEM’s and CSR’s.
